
One of Louis Vuitton (LV) creations that is well known worldwide is LV coated canvas. It is soft yet extra durable and scratch resistant. LV’s coated-canvas bags could maintain their shape and look even after few decades. Not to mention, the pattern is recognizable. Probably only few persons in this world who don’t know what LV is.
But do you know that LV coated canvas is non-leather? The material is cotton canvas that has been treated with well known plastic PVC (polyvinylchloride). That’s why this material will last for a very long time. You can count it as investment if you’re the kind of person who prefer quality than quantity.
Some of you might probably think, since LV coated canvas bags are made from cotton canvas and PVC, isn’t it supposed to be cheap? Well even though the main material is made from non-leather material, the trim is made from real animal leather. And please don’t forget that one LV bag is produced through tons of process by skillful craftsman. No matter how expensive or good materials are, without meticulous craftsmanship, it will be only raw material without any added value.
